如何高效制作并美化百度歌曲排行榜的CSS样式?
制作一个百度歌曲排行榜CSS:实战教程

随着互联网的快速发展,音乐已经成为人们生活中不可或缺的一部分,百度歌曲排行榜作为国内最具影响力的音乐榜单之一,其页面设计的美观与用户体验至关重要,本文将详细介绍如何制作一个具有专业、权威、可信和良好体验的百度歌曲排行榜CSS样式。
页面布局
-
使用HTML5和CSS3构建页面结构,确保兼容性。
-
采用响应式设计,适配不同设备。
-
页面结构如下:
| 元素 | 描述 |
|---|---|
| header | 页面头部,包含网站logo、导航栏等 |
| section | 排行榜主体,展示歌曲信息 |
| footer | 页面底部,包含版权信息、联系方式等 |
CSS样式
首先设置全局样式,包括字体、颜色、背景等。
body {
fontfamily: 'Arial', sansserif;
backgroundcolor: #f4f4f4;
margin: 0;
padding: 0;
}
a {
color: #0066cc;
textdecoration: none;
}
.container {
width: 1200px;
margin: 0 auto;
padding: 20px;
}
设计header样式。

header {
backgroundcolor: #fff;
padding: 10px 0;
}
header h1 {
margin: 0;
padding: 0 20px;
}
nav ul {
liststyle: none;
margin: 0;
padding: 0;
}
nav ul li {
display: inline;
marginright: 20px;
}
nav ul li a {
padding: 5px 10px;
border: 1px solid #ddd;
borderradius: 5px;
}
设计section样式。
section {
backgroundcolor: #fff;
margintop: 20px;
padding: 20px;
}
table {
width: 100%;
bordercollapse: collapse;
}
table th,
table td {
textalign: center;
border: 1px solid #ddd;
padding: 10px;
}
table th {
backgroundcolor: #f5f5f5;
}
table tr:nthchild(even) {
backgroundcolor: #f9f9f9;
}
设计footer样式。
footer {
backgroundcolor: #333;
color: #fff;
padding: 20px 0;
textalign: center;
}
footer p {
margin: 0;
padding: 0;
}
经验案例
以某知名音乐网站为例,该网站在制作百度歌曲排行榜时,采用了以下策略:
-
优化页面加载速度,提升用户体验。
-
采用扁平化设计,使页面更加简洁美观。
-
利用CSS3动画效果,增强页面动态感。
-
优化交互设计,如鼠标悬停显示歌曲详细信息等。

FAQs
问题:如何使表格边框更加美观?
解答:可以使用CSS的borderradius属性,为表格边框添加圆角效果。
问题:如何实现表格隔行变色?
解答:可以使用CSS的nthchild(even)选择器,为偶数行添加背景颜色。
文献权威来源
-
《CSS权威指南》(第4版)
-
《HTML与CSS设计精粹》
-
《响应式网页设计》
通过以上教程,相信您已经掌握了制作百度歌曲排行榜CSS的方法,在实际操作过程中,请结合自身需求进行优化,以达到最佳效果。
您可能感兴趣的文章
- 05-12网页制作马的html怎么做,网页制作马的html
- 05-12html网页制作手机app怎么做,html网页制作手机app
- 05-12html css个人制作网页,个人制作网页用什么软件
- 05-12用html制作网页课表,如何用html代码制作课表
- 05-12超简单html网页制作怎么做,html网页制作
- 05-12html用table制作网页,如何用html的table标签制作网页
- 05-12在html网页制作表格,html制作表格代码
- 05-12html网页制作全代码是什么,html网页制作全代码
- 05-12网页制作的模板html是什么?网页制作模板html哪里下载
- 05-12html企业网页制作怎么做?html企业网页制作多少钱
阅读排行
推荐教程
- 03-25CSS实现两列布局的N种方法
- 09-11如何用CSS实现精准布局和炫酷动效?前端大神都在用的实战技巧大公开!
- 03-25CSS3中Animation实现简单的手指点击动画的示例
- 09-11如何用CSS代码实现专业级网页布局?
- 03-25详解overflow:hidden的作用(溢出隐藏、清除浮动、解决外边距塌陷)
- 02-01CSS制作三角形,从基础到进阶,打造炫酷网页元素 如何用CSS绘制三角形?这些隐藏技巧让你
- 03-25CSS实现隐藏搜索框功能(动画正反向序列)
- 01-31“为什么你的网页设计总不够专业?这些CSS技巧让你秒懂网页制作精髓!”
- 09-11为什么说精通CSS是前端工程师的分水岭?这些核心技术你掌握了吗?
- 04-29使用CSS实现一个同态效果
